It's been a little over two years since the Uvalde tragedy, and yet, here we are again. Another school shooting—this time not far from my home, just 40 minutes from where I live in Georgia. This isn't just a news headline anymore; it's a painful reality, one that we keep reliving.
Why can’t we find a solution to gun violence that actually works? Why do we keep doing the same things and expecting different results? Today, I’m revisiting an episode that asked a bold question: Is the private sector the key to ending gun violence?
Interestingly, an Atlanta-based company provided devices that helped mitigate the damage in this most recent tragedy, which brings me to a bigger question: Are we really leaving this fight to tech solutions alone? Is that enough?
I challenge my fellow entrepreneurs, innovators, and capitalists to think bigger. We can’t keep leaving this issue to policy makers alone. But, at the same time, I’m also calling for real, meaningful change in our laws. We need action from every side. Something has to change. And it has to happen now.
